【技术实现步骤摘要】
区块链监管方法和系统
[0001]本申请涉及区块链
,特别是涉及一种区块链监管方法和系统。
技术介绍
[0002]区块链系统是一种分布式存储、点对点传输的基于共识机制、加密算法等技术的新型应用模式,其具有的不可篡改、公开透明的特性解决了很多问题,因此被广泛使用,但也带来了信息安全的问题。目前各个区块链系统都是有各个对等节点自行将数据写入区块链系统及从区块链系统上读取数据,其中可能包含错误或违规的信息,这些错误或违规的信息一经上链,可能会造成广泛传播。因此需求对区块链数据进行监管。
[0003]传统技术中,对于区块链系统的监管主要是在数据上链前,通过中心服务或者监管机构服务对待上链的信息进行审核和过滤,以实现防止违规信息上链的目的。但是,对于已经上链的违规信息,目前并没有有效的监管方法;因此,如何对已上链的违规信息进行有效监管,已成为亟待解决的问题。
技术实现思路
[0004]基于此,有必要针对上述技术问题,提供一种能够对已上链的违规信息进行有效监管的区块链监管方法和系统。
[0005]一 ...
【技术保护点】
【技术特征摘要】
1.一种区块链监管方法,其特征在于,应用于区块链系统,所述区块链系统包括监管节点和不少于一个共识节点,所述方法包括:所述共识节点将自身的普通合约注册至监管合约中;所述监管合约是部署于所述监管节点中的能够实现增加或删除监管策略的智能合约;所述监管策略是所述监管节点对所述区块链系统进行监管的规则;所述监管节点根据预设的扫描规则对所述区块链系统进行扫描,获取扫描结果;所述监管节点根据所述扫描结果对所述区块链系统进行监管。2.根据权利要求1所述的方法,其特征在于,所述监管节点根据预设的扫描规则对所述区块链系统进行扫描包括:所述监管节点按照预设的扫描周期对所述区块链系统进行扫描,和/或所述监管节点判断所述监管合约中的监管策略是否发生变化,若所述监管策略发生变化,所述监管节点对所述区块链系统进行扫描。3.根据权利要求2所述的方法,其特征在于,所述监管节点根据所述扫描结果对所述区块链系统进行监管包括:所述监管节点根据所述扫描结果判断所述区块链系统中是否存在违规信息;若所述区块链系统中存在违规信息,所述监管节点根据所述违规信息对所述共识节点进行监管。4.根据权利要求3所述的方法,其特征在于,所述监管节点根据所述违规信息对所述共识节点进行监管包括:所述监管节点删除所述共识节点对所述违规信息的读取权限。5.根据权利要求3所述的方法,其特征在于,所述监管节点根据所述扫描结果对所述区块链系统进行监管还包括:所述监管节点根据所述扫描结果判断所述区块链系统中是否存在不再违规的信息;所述不再违规的信息是指根据所述监管策略,在扫描时不再属于违规信息的原违规信息;若所述区...
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。